Etymology 1

Acronym of mother I'd like to fuck, mom I'd like to fuck, mum I'd like to fuck (and similar variants).

First attested in 1992 among college students in the East Bay of San Francisco, popularized via the sex comedy American Pie (1999) and the porn industry.
